💡undeceive (an-di-siv)

verb
/ˌʌn.dɪˈsiːv/
desengañar (desenganar)

Meaning

To free someone from a misconception or false belief.
Traducción del significado
Liberar a alguien de una idea equivocada o creencia falsa.

Oraciones de ejemplo

She tried to undeceive him about the false rumors.

Ella trató de desengañarlo sobre los rumores falsos.

Synonyms

enlighten, clarify, correct, inform

Antonyms

deceive, mislead

Colocaciones

undeceive someone, undeceive the public
